Moving from Netherlands to Switzerland: Distance, Routes and Timing

Most relocations between the Netherlands and Switzerland are completed by road transport.

Popular routes include:

RouteApproximate Distance
Amsterdam to Zurich820 km
Rotterdam to Basel690 km
Utrecht to Geneva870 km
Eindhoven to Zurich670 km
Maastricht to Basel520 km

Documents Needed When Moving to Switzerland from Netherlands

Documentation is one of the most important parts of moving to Switzerland from Netherlands.

Swiss Customs Requirements

Official Swiss customs guidance:

https://www.bazg.admin.ch/en/moving-household-effects

https://www.bazg.admin.ch/en/relocation-import-switzerland-procedure

Typical documents include:

  • Passport or national ID
  • Inventory of household goods
  • Proof of residence transfer
  • Swiss address details
  • Customs declaration forms
  • Evidence that goods are personal household effects

A detailed inventory helps customs officers process your relocation more efficiently.

Residence and Permit Requirements

Official Swiss guidance:

https://www.ch.ch/en/documents-and-register-extracts/permits-for-living-in-switzerland

Depending on your circumstances, you may need:

  • Residence registration
  • Employment contract
  • Proof of accommodation
  • Health insurance details
  • Valid identification

Working in Switzerland

Official information:

https://www.ch.ch/en/foreign-nationals-in-switzerland/working-in-switzerland

Permit requirements vary depending on your employment situation and canton of residence.

Deregistering in the Netherlands

Official guidance:

https://www.netherlandsworldwide.nl/moving-abroad

https://www.netherlandsworldwide.nl/personal-records-database-brp/how-deregister-brp

If you plan to live abroad for more than eight months, you may need to deregister from your Dutch municipality before departure.

Customs Tips for Moving Household Goods into Switzerland

Customs preparation is one of the most important aspects of moving to Switzerland from Netherlands.

Official guidance:

https://www.bazg.admin.ch/en/moving-household-effects

Helpful tips:

  • Prepare a detailed inventory
  • Keep documents accessible
  • Separate personal belongings from commercial goods
  • Verify rules for vehicles, pets, alcohol, and restricted items
  • Keep proof of residence transfer available
  • Confirm your Swiss address details

Good preparation can significantly reduce delays at the border.

Moving to Switzerland from Netherlands Checklist

Time Before MoveAction
8-12 weeksResearch housing, permits, schools, and employment
6-8 weeksRequest quotes and prepare inventory
4-6 weeksBook your removals service
3-4 weeksGather customs and residence documents
2-3 weeksBegin packing
1 weekConfirm access and parking arrangements
Moving dayKeep valuables and documents with you
Delivery dayInspect belongings and verify inventory

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Many relocation problems can be avoided with proper planning.

Common mistakes include:

  • Assuming Switzerland follows EU customs rules
  • Choosing the wrong vehicle size
  • Delaying customs paperwork
  • Using poor-quality packing materials
  • Ignoring parking restrictions
  • Booking too late
  • Forgetting Dutch deregistration requirements

A successful move is usually the result of preparation rather than luck.
